WebbFor example, in version 10.1 and above, MariaDB stores JSON data in a different format than MySQL 5.7 does. To compensate, users looking to replicate columns of JSON objects from MySQL to MariaDB need to either convert them to the format used by the latter or run statement-based replication jobs via SQL. Webb12 okt. 2024 · This probably means that your libc libraries are not 100 % compatible with this binary MariaDB version. The MariaDB daemon, mysqld, should work normally with the exception that host name resolving will not work. This means that you should use IP addresses instead of hostnames when specifying MariaDB privileges !

WebbMariaDB should now be ready to use. Rocky Linux 9.0 Changes¶. Rocky Linux 9.0 uses mariadb-server-10.5.13-2 as the default mariadb-server version. As of version 10.4.3, a new plugin is automatically enabled in the server which changes the mariadb-secure-installation dialog. That plugin is unix-socket authentication.This article explains the new feature well. WebbMariaDB is a reliable, high performance and full-featured database server which aims to be an 'always Free, backward compatible, drop-in' replacement of MySQL. Since 2013 MariaDB is Arch Linux's default implementation of MySQL. [1] Installation MariaDB is the default implementation of MySQL in Arch Linux, provided with the mariadb package. Tip:
